<p>SpineHope was founded in 2008 in an effort to combat spinal disorders through an increase in education and awareness, expansion of research, and transformational surgeries for children in need. Since their founding, SpineHope has helped assess hundreds of patients with spinal disorders, providing many with critical surgery and a better way of living.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-3560 outlinedphoto" title="Accepting donations via vending machines offers an effective new fundraising idea." src="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Accepting-donations-via-vending-machines-offer-an-effective-new-fundraising-idea-241x300.jpg" alt="" width="241" height="300" />Non-profits the world over are always on the lookout for innovative, new <a href="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/fundraising-items/">fundraising ideas</a> to generate support for their causes. We recently came across one such idea that hasn’t received overwhelming attention — at least not yet.</p>
<p>We’re talking about vending machines. That’s right, you heard right — vending machines. The same machines that deliver you your favorite candy bars and sugary beverages now provide hungry and thirsty consumers around the world the opportunity to make charitable donations while consuming. First introduced in Japan, this <a href="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/fundraising-items/">fundraising idea</a> has made its way overseas to Brazil, and is expected to make an impact in major cities all over the world soon.</p>
<p>More than 10 million people commute via public transportation each and every day in New York City.  Imagine what might happen if just 1-percent of those commuters donated a single dollar each day. In just one day, $100,000 would be raised, without anyone having to go out of his or her way.</p>
<p><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-3561 outlinedphoto" title="New York City and other metropolitan areas in North America offer big opportunities for charity fundraising with vending machines." src="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/New-York-City-and-other-metropolitan-areas-in-North-America-offer-big-opportunities-for-charity-fundraising-with-vending-machines.jpg" alt="" width="299" height="169" />That’s exactly what happened in Japan when a local Coca-Cola bottling company teamed up with the Japanese Red Cross to encourage post-tsunami support. Consumers were provided the opportunity to offer a charitable contribution to the Japanese Red Cross, along with or instead of their beverage purchase, earning them a thank you from an automated system upon completing their transactions.  And, if that wasn’t enough, the Coca-Cola Company also donated a percentage of its beverage sales directly to the Japanese Red Cross, further supporting the program.</p>
<p>In São Paulo, Brazil, the city’s public transportation systems have also become accustomed to this innovative, new <a href="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/fundraising-items/">fundraising idea</a>. Vending machines in their subway system now include simple thank you cards, which are earned by making charitable donations that help keep local children off the streets.</p>
<p>With such a large market that relies on public transportation in major cities across North America and Europe, it’s only a matter of time before this groundbreaking <a href="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/fundraising-items/">fundraising idea</a> reaches its full potential here in the U.S. and beyond. For many major nonprofits out there, this may be the first of many alternative fundraising techniques that arise from ongoing technological advancements.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-3538" title="Charities worldwide will benefit from the generosity of the super rich via The Giving Pledge." src="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/Charities-worldwide-will-benefit-from-the-generosity-of-the-super-rich-via-The-Giving-Pledge-300x59.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="59" />What would you do with a billion dollars? We’re sure you can think of a million things you’d like buy or places you’d like to visit, but would you ever consider giving it all away? Well, maybe not all of it. But, imagine giving the majority of your wealth to worthy causes around the world, supporting millions of people in need. That’s the vision of world-renowned billionaires Bill Gates and Warren Buffet. Together they’ve created The Giving Pledge, one of the most ingenious <a href="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/fundraising-items/">fundraising ideas</a> ever devised. They’ve asked all of the billionaires in the United States to donate their fortunes, either before or after they die, leaving at least 50-percent of their assets to the charities of their choice. This bold act of generosity has earned the support of prominent billionaires, including New York Mayor Michael Bloomberg, film producer George Lucas, Facebook creator Mark Zuckerberg, and hotel tycoon Barron Hilton, to name just a few.</p>
<p>The mission of this pledge is clear-cut: Give back excessive wealth in an effort to make an real difference in the world. Buffet and Gates haven’t asked for these funds to go to any charity specifically, nor have they asked for any kind of signed contract. All they’ve asked for is a moral commitment to donate to any charitable organization that each individual feels passionate about. <img class="alignright size-full wp-image-3539 outlinedphoto" title="The giving pledge is a unique fundraising idea from some of the world's wealthiest people." src="http://charityfundraising.autographstore.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/The-giving-pledge-is-a-unique-fundraising-idea-from-some-of-the-worlds-wealthiest-people.jpg" alt="" width="241" height="209" />Buffet himself has decided to donate over 99-percent of his entire fortune to charity, leaving the less than 1-percent remaining to his family. Some people may call him crazy, but the way Buffet looks at it, if he’d left any more money to his family, it would not enhance their well being or way of life in any genuine way. But, by giving up so much, he can effectively improve the health and well being of so many other people in this world with one simple act of kindness.</p>
